§ 30-31. Definitions.  


Latest version.
  • The following words, terms and phrases, when used in this article, shall have the meanings ascribed to them in this section, except where the context clearly indicates a different meaning:

    Weeds means and includes all rank vegetable growth (all grasses, weeds, brush, vines and undergrowth) which emit obnoxious or unpleasant odors or which might be a source of disease of physical distress to human beings, and such term shall also be deemed to include all high and rank vegetable growth that may conceal pools of water, trash, filth or any other deposits which may be detrimental to health if, in the opinion of the building official or code compliance officer, or authorized agent, such condition endangers the health, safety or welfare of any member of the community.

(Code 1985, § 94.20; Ord. No. 89-11, § 1(94.20), 7-11-89)
